Add 12/3 and 6/42
1st number: 4 0/3, 2nd number: 6/42
12/3 + 6/42 is 29/7.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 3 and 42 is 42
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42 - For the 1st fraction, since 3 × 14 = 42,
12/3 = 12 × 14/3 × 14 = 168/42 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 42 × 1 = 42,
6/42 = 6 × 1/42 × 1 = 6/42 - Add the two like fractions:
168/42 + 6/42 = 168 + 6/42 = 174/42 - 174/42 simplified gives 29/7
- So, 12/3 + 6/42 = 29/7
